Multiple Measurements, One Setup

Accelerate 5G and satellite communication component characterization with the Keysight E5081A ENA-X vector network analyzer (VNA). The ENA-X is the only solution that produces fast and accurate EVM measurements on a mid-range network analyzer.

Our spectral correlation technique directly analyzes the modulated input and output signals in the frequency domain on the network analyzer. Current solutions on the market require a network and spectrum analyzer to characterize components fully. With the new ENA-X, you can ensure test accuracy and repeatability with a single test setup using full vector correction at the DUT plane. Avoid manually reconfiguring setups or automating complex switch-based systems — verify device performance faster and with less error potential with the ENA-X network analyzer.
